Transfer an Out-of-State Motorcycle License When Moving to Minnesota

If you’ve recently moved to Minnesota, you can transfer your out-of-state motorcycle license or endorsement. To do so:

  • Visit your local DPS office within 60 days of establishing residency.
  • Surrender your out-of-state license.
  • Complete the application and provide proof of your identity, residency, and legal presence. 
  • Pay the required application fees.
  • Pass an eye exam.
  • Pass the Minnesota motorcycle written exam.

If your out-of-state motorcycle license/endorsement is valid you typically will not need to pass a road test or complete another motorcycle safety course.
